Shanghai Lockdown Resolved, Air Freight Volume Recovers Significantly

  • Jun 12, 2022
  • 1 min read

With the lockdown of Shanghai, China, (the elimination of the city blockade), cargo traffic at the airport has been recovering on a sustained basis, and the cargo traffic of major air logistics companies has already recovered to 80% of its normal level. China Cargo (CKK/CK), which handles about half of the cargo traffic at Shanghai Pudong International Airport (PVG), operated 754 cargo flights in and out of Shanghai, transporting a total of 16,924 tons, up 127.6% year-on-year.
